1,首先不太理解JAVA SE和JAVA EE的主要区别是什么?
2,我的方向主要是JAVA服务端开发,非WEB方向,这属于什么类别?
3,有什么比较轻量并且优秀的书,我关注的主要是语法和常用标准库。谢谢啦。

解决方案 »

  1.   


    SE:桌面程序,EE:web程序。
    服务器端非web? 我猜应该还是EE方面的。
    对楼主这水平的,JDK文档最好了。
      

  2.   

    《张孝祥java就业培训教程》
    这本书写的通俗易懂
      

  3.   

    推荐《Thinking in java》,Java SE = Java Standard Edition, Java EE = Java Enterprise Edition。
    Java SE 主要是包括些基本Java语法。Java EE主要包括 JSP,Structs2,Hibernate,Spring等,它们涉及的基本知识除Java基本使用之外,还包括了Html,xml,css等知识。
      

  4.   


    EE就是WEB方向了, 那我想学java se基本语法和一些常用标准库,不想了解太多程序设计上的东西,有这种简单一点的书吗,think in java太重了。
      

  5.   


    EE就是WEB方向了, 那我想学java se基本语法和一些常用标准库,不想了解太多程序设计上的东西,有这种简单一点的书吗,think in java太重了。那你检索找下国产Java基础教程,简单,入门必备。如果想深入,后期拿thinking in java当工具书。
      

  6.   

    版主大大欢迎来Java版啊,哈哈1,首先不太理解JAVA SE和JAVA EE的主要区别是什么?
    Java SE = Java Standard Edition。 适用于桌面系统的Java 2平台标准版(Java2 Platform Standard Edition,Java SE)
    Java EE = Java Enterprise Edition。适用于创建服务器应用程序和服务的Java 2平台企业版(Java2 Platform Enterprise Edition,Java EE)。 这里要说下Java EE 不是所谓的web程序,而是一套标准,通常大家会这么理解,只不过是由于EE好多是以web形式的产品,所以大家会理解J2EE就是JAVA WEB。2,我的方向主要是JAVA服务端开发,非WEB方向,这属于什么类别?
    和C++类似,J2SE,还需要知道一些框架知识,如持久化的,MVC的。如果是游戏服务器啥的,那算法和j2se差不多了。3,有什么比较轻量并且优秀的书,我关注的主要是语法和常用标准库。
    Core Java 卷I 和 卷II
      

  7.   

    EE就是WEB方向了, 那我想学java se基本语法和一些常用标准库,不想了解太多程序设计上的东西,有这种简单一点的书吗,think in java太重了。那你检索找下国产Java基础教程,简单,入门必备。如果想深入,后期拿thinking in java当工具书。谢谢两位帮助.
      

  8.   

    我上学时用过的一本教材不错,首先它不厚,然后它内容也详细清楚,不烦冗,--<java程序设计实用教程> --叶核亚等主编
      

  9.   

    SE是PC端的  EE是服务器的  ME是手机等移动端的书嘛 《Thinking in java》最好 主要讲的都是SE的东西 我觉得应该先从基础学起
      

  10.   


    EE就是WEB方向了, 那我想学java se基本语法和一些常用标准库,不想了解太多程序设计上的东西,有这种简单一点的书吗,think in java太重了。搞服务端开发不用web用啥? 要用socket吗?
      

  11.   

    《java开发实战经典》李兴华老师写的,再简单不过了,网上搜搜,视频、电子书都有。再深入一点的《疯狂java讲义》李刚老师写的。再深入一点的,就是老外写的,值得推荐的有《java核心技术卷I》和《java核心技术卷II》,再深入的,《Think in java》也就是中文版的《java编程思想》第四版。以上这些都是个人感受。楼主可以根据个人喜好参考。《java编程思想》看5遍以上,你绝对就是高手了!
      

  12.   

    基础的随便国产的看看语法都可以吧。再下去就是《java核心技术卷I》和《java核心技术卷II》,深入的就是Think in java》了吧。还有下去就是effective java
      

  13.   

    C++大神学JAVA基本不用看什么书了吧
      

  14.   

    With the advancement of Old School Runescape Gold technology, this game version has been revamped with all additional features. After Diablo 2, the Old School Runescape Gold monkeyrelease for Diablo 3 is yet to be known. The Diablo 3 game is truly challenging, as they are designed cutting-edge techniques. 
      

  15.   

    1.SE:桌面应用程序,客户端(服务器端是不是也是客户端)
    EE:企业级应用程序,服务器端
    2.JAVA服务端开发,非WEB方向——应该离不开WEB吧
    3.书就看感觉买吧